Moodle launches Moodle for School


The world’s most widely-used learning platform presents Moodle for School, a MoodleCloud hosted solution specifically designed for K-12 educational environments

Moodle, an open source learning platform, announced Moodle for School, the latest initiative from MoodleCloud. Moodle for School has been created specifically for schools and educational settings with features that let educators set gamification goals and keep track of attendance.

The package includes a friendly new configurable theme as well as a number of special customisations to make it ideal for K-12 teaching and learning environments. There is also a collaboration function that lets up to six users connect virtually via audio or video. A separate module turns quizzes into games for students.

Moodle is hosted (and priced) by number of users — thus a single teacher using the platform might get it for free. But educators and schools requiring multiple users grouped together might need to consider a larger, paid package (the maximum number of users for a single package is 500).  File upload space scales along with number of users.

Other features of the Moodle for School package include:

  • Hosted by MoodleCloud
  • The latest version of Moodle, Moodle 3.1
  • Automatic Moodle version updates
  • A range of popular plugins including video-conferencing and gamification tools
  • Unlimited courses and activities
  • Brand new, configurable theme to add your own colours, styles and logo
  • Available in over 100 languages with multilingual capability
  • Full support for Moodle’s official app – Moodle Mobile

Moodle for School is available from https://moodlecloud.com. The package is comes in three sizes, suitable for schools with under 500 staff and students.

These new plans are available alongside the existing MoodleCloud package, Moodle for Free, which can facilitate very small educational setups, individual teachers or users looking to explore Moodle features.
